Margaret River, a charming town in western Australia, is famous for its craft breweries, boutiques, and surrounding wineries. The area boasts stunning beaches and surf breaks along the coast where migratory whales can be spotted from June to November. The Cape to Cape Track offers a long-distance walk between two lighthouses north and south of the town, showcasing limestone caves and sea cliffs in Leeuwin-Naturaliste National Park.

Wooditjup National Park, located in Australia's South-West, is a stunning destination known for its walking paths and mountain bike trails. The park is home to abundant flora and fauna, offering visitors the opportunity to observe endemic species as they explore the hiking and biking trails. While the area has undergone changes due to pine plantation harvesting, there are still op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ts to enjoy the natural beauty of this park.

This is a national park just north and east of the Albany town centre. There is a fair sized carpark at the trailhead for a handful of walking and cycling tracks through mature forests filled with Karri, Marri and Jarrah Trees. We used the carpark along Craters Road past Rotary Park where there are several trailheads for both walkers and bikers. Trail information is posted at the carpark as well. The RAC Campground is located nearby as well and includes access to the Wooditjup Trails. We found the Chimney Trail to be quite easy and family-friendly. A lot of criss-crossing and short splinter trails so best to have a map ready to make sure you stay on the correct path. The historic Red Chimney makes for a nice stop along this trail. The longer distance Wadandi Track also transects the NP. We walked a couple km of this trail across several bridges as well, that was nice stretch with direct access to the carpark used. Another easy and family friendly trail we found enjoyable for a leisurely late morning hike was the Rotary South Bank River Trail which you can start from the Rotary Park carpark. This was a very easy, child and pet friendly walk, perfect for families wanting to spend some time in nature close to the town centre.

Discover the captivating world of glass art at Melting Pot Glass Studio in Margaret River, Western Australia. Founded by renowned glass artist Gerry Reilly and Margot Edwards, this studio offers a diverse collection of exquisite crystal creations, including vibrant vases, paperweights, and unique tide pool and rock pool platters. Visitors can immerse themselves in the artistry through hot glassmaking demonstrations and hands-on experiences for all ages.

The Rotary Park is off Bussell Highway just north of the main town centre at Margaret River. This is a good city park with riverside walking trails. We walked the South Bank River Trail Loop which is an easy 2.3 circular trail, good for families, dog-walkers and those who prefer to take it easy. You'll also find children's playground, BBQ, facilities, parking and access to the historic Early Settlement buildings and structures and late 19th-century Kate locomotive is on display at and around Rotary Park.
